[meta-freescale] [meta-fsl-arm] libmcc sysroot issues

Otavio Salvador otavio at ossystems.com.br
Wed Jan 7 07:51:26 PST 2015


On Wed, Jan 7, 2015 at 12:41 PM, Max Krummenacher <max.oss.09 at gmail.com> wrote:
>> I'll try a build here to see if I can reproduce the issue you are seeing. Recently this commit b542d3ba472b04fd8759fc34baeda1
> e7bba31910 addressed some issues with the libmcc install recipes.
> Copying Max (the commit author) in case this is a familiar issue or
> perhaps the issue was introduced by that change.
>
> I don't think that the patch which fixes the do_install in dizzy does
> contribute to the issues Petr has. I did compare the content installed
> in daisy which what is now in dizzy. Now change between the two.

Agreed. It is not related.

> We did address the first issue by adding an include path to the
> sysroots /usr/src/kernel. As we used libmcc from a recipe the linker
> automatically statically linked libmcc without any bitbake warning or
> error output. Probably libmcc.a is by default not populated in an SDK.
> Otavio's patches do address the root cause, while our approach is a
> cheap workaround.

I tried to keep the fixes isolated. The linux/version.h issue will be
fixed in OE-Core as yesterday we narrowed down the issue. So I will
drop it in v3 when I send it.

> I will retest with the latest patches from Otavio with real hardware.
> Although that will require a day or two.

Awesome. Please wait for the v3 to do so.

-- 
Otavio Salvador                             O.S. Systems
http://www.ossystems.com.br        http://code.ossystems.com.br
Mobile: +55 (53) 9981-7854            Mobile: +1 (347) 903-9750


More information about the meta-freescale mailing list